Title: Survey Operations Manager
Rio de Janeiro, BR
Introduction
Are you an experienced Survey professional ready to lead high-performing teams and deliver excellence across complex offshore energy projects?
Subsea7 is seeking a Survey Operations Manager to lead our Survey function within the GPC West Brazil region. Reporting to the Global Survey & Inspection Manager, you will play a key role in supporting subsea construction, SURF and PLSV operations, ensuring safe, efficient and high-quality survey service delivery while driving operational performance, innovation and continuous improvement.
What will you be doing?
- Lead and develop a team of onshore and offshore survey professionals, fostering a culture of safety, performance and collaboration.
- Ensure the successful delivery of survey services across regional projects and operations.
- Manage resource planning, forecasting and workforce utilisation to meet project and business demands.
- Support tendering activities through review of survey methodologies, costs, equipment and third-party requirements.
- Oversee budgets, cost control and operational performance to maximise efficiency and value.
- Build strong relationships with project teams, clients, suppliers and internal stakeholders.
- Drive continuous improvement through technology adoption, innovation and implementation of industry best practices.
- Champion HSEQ standards, operational excellence and lessons learned across the region
What experience would we like you to have?
- Degree qualification in Surveying, Geomatics, Hydrography, Engineering, Earth Sciences or a related discipline.
- Significant offshore survey experience within the offshore energy industry.
- Proven leadership experience managing multidisciplinary teams in operational environments.
- Strong understanding of survey technologies, project delivery, operational risk management and industry best practice.
- Experience managing budgets, forecasts, tendering activities and resource optimisation.
- Demonstrated ability to influence stakeholders and build trusted customer relationships.
- Experience driving performance improvement, innovation and strategic business initiatives.
- Competency in Microsoft 365 applications; experience with Power BI, ERP or resource planning systems would be advantageous.
